Transaction 15621b08f84d5549e337bf459d6646e33f0520f7576788f80135df0e46ef6d88

1 Input
2 Outputs
  • 15621b08f84d5549e337bf459d6646e33f0520f7576788f80135df0e46ef6d88:0
  • value  500000000
    address  376MW84bRvVnfNz9KZXVEG1fPfzbV1sJuQ
  • 15621b08f84d5549e337bf459d6646e33f0520f7576788f80135df0e46ef6d88:1
  • value  49992086
    address  353yL6Z7xNkWqkA9sAd8cu1crSjwsugcT8